
作为一名程序员,我通常更喜欢从晚饭后开始编程直到凌晨,然后几乎在每个周末都睡觉。当他们尽力而为时请问一个随机的程序员,他们很可能会承认很多深夜。 一种流行的趋势是在凌晨起床并在一天的琐事开始之前完成一些工作。 其他人则喜欢从晚上开始,一直工作到凌晨。
因此,有一些原因使这段时间成为更好的编码时间:
1.无固定干扰
没有什么可打扰您的孤独的。 白天进行此操作通常意味着必须处理人,电话,短信和生活等形式的干扰。如果您是员工,则需要参加会议,处理经理和客户的要求,并不断检查社交个人资料和通知,来自同事的干扰,如果还剩下一点时间,那么就开始对您可能感兴趣或不感兴趣的项目进行编码。 但是在晚上的凌晨,没有人打扰您,也没有社交通知打扰您,您可以只在所需的项目上进行编码。
2.和平安静
同样,您周围无休止活动的背景噪音,如汽车经过,人们交谈以及夜晚什么都不会变得完全静音–如此之多,您就可以让别针静音。 如果那不是工作或放松的理想氛围,我不知道是什么。 你们中有些人可能会说,通过使用降噪耳机让树林在白天聆听自己喜欢的音乐,我们可以在白天拥有类似的氛围。但是应避免经常听耳机上的音乐,以保持您的听力健康。 实际上建议不要连续使用耳机一个小时以上,并且之间要经常休息一下。晚上安静的气氛实际上对于进行诸如编码之类的精神刺激任务感觉要好得多。
“拥有内心的平静,一切皆有可能”
-功夫熊猫师傅
3.越黑越好
即使在白天,许多开发人员还是喜欢绘制所有的窗帘并以任何可能的方式将灯光挡在外面。
4.没有像午夜小吃
以程序员为例,并添加一个存货充足的厨房/冰箱-您将成为地球上最快乐的人。 与典型的早起的早午餐-晚餐不同,这里有下午早餐,夜间午餐和午夜小吃! 它的创造力值得称赞-剩下的三明治,花生酱菜肴等等。但是即使在晚上也要继续吃健康的零食,而不是像在冷饮和披萨上暴饮暴食。
5.深夜最好的大脑工作
研究表明,虽然早起的鸟儿的注意力范围会随着白天的发展而逐渐减少,但它会一直活跃到一整夜,直到深夜/真正的清晨,大脑已经足够疲倦以至于可以仅专注于一项任务,而不是多项任务。 因此,它选择专注于编程,而不是阅读新闻或检查社交应用程序,这也很好地证明了睡眠中发生的梦想是大脑调和前一天的事件并建立新的理解的过程的一部分和直觉。 与该过程联系的最佳方法是早晨躺在一小段时间,半小时左右睡一个小时。取得进展的最佳方法是解决问题,直到一天的最后一刻。然后直接去睡觉。 没有人,没有电视,没有社交媒体互动。 早晨,在清晨的曙光中,昨天的问题可能会提出解决方案。
6.夜猫子/早起的鸟儿更聪明
毫无疑问,研究已经证明夜猫子/早起的鸟儿比其他人更聪明和更有创造力,因此,这里是个好消息! 难怪所有著名的创意人士都是夜猫子或早起的人
伟人到达并保持的高度并没有通过突然的飞行而达到,但是他们,而他们的同伴睡眠在深夜中奋力向上!
–亨利·朗费罗
7.与人互动最少
我们通常对人的公司比较尴尬,宁愿与他们尽可能少地交往,没有什么比成为一名程序员更好的了。 您不仅不必在夜间看到它们-因为每个人都在睡觉,甚至在白天也可以避免它们-因为您在睡觉!
8,过去的影响
对于年长的程序员,它可以追溯到90年代初,当时他们拥有公司中每个人都共享的服务器,但是这些服务器的功能还不足以支持每个人同时使用它们。 这些机器繁忙时,它们的速度将比轻载时的速度慢几十倍。 因此,您要等到深夜,这样才能测试项目并获得比其他所有人都在系统上敲门的白天更多的代码编译运行调试周期。向上连接比晚上使用网络连接更好,而不是在线路繁忙时使用它们。最终,服务器变得更强大且更具成本效益,而网络连接的带宽却增加了,但随后出现了夜间工作的趋势。
9,你在流
有些人称它为“连接”,“流程”或“区域”,但这是我们大多数人都熟悉的阶段。您开始全神贯注地处理问题,而将周围的世界抛在脑后,只是在等待。您从几分钟前开始花费了数小时的时间,甚至没有意识到。源头确实从大脑流向了源头。在这样的凌晨,您很可能会参与到开发项目的过程中不考虑周围发生的事情。
无论您希望在什么时间工作,都请牢记开发人员不是肤浅的人,需要像其他所有人一样需要充足的睡眠,因此请务必确保您有足够的睡眠时间并制定适当的睡眠时间表以防止白天感觉疲惫不堪。
您可以通过以下链接查看我的其他文章:
技术学
技术经济学是罗伊·阿斯科特(Roy Ascott)创造的一个术语,它指的是技术和意识研究的新兴领域…… technoetics.in
如果您喜欢本文,请单击页面底部的♥,并在评论部分中提及视图/改进/建议。
图片来源:svgimages